Webb23 juni 1998 · The synthesis of AdoMet is, however, the major route for methionine metabolism; 80% of this amino acid is being engaged in this reaction (Fig. 2) ( 16 ). Two pathways using the methyl or the 4-carbon moieties of methionine and involving AdoMet as a first intermediate have been described in plants. WebbSerotonin Synthesis and Metabolism. Serotonin (5-hydroxytryptamine) is principally found stored in three main cell types - i) serotonergic neurons in the CNS and in the intestinal myenteric plexus, ii) enterochromaffin cells in the mucosa of the gastrointestinal tract, and iii) in blood platelets.
